Relaxation Events in Itasca
Check out happening relaxation events all around Itasca, IL
Weekend Wellness Retreat
Fri, 11 Apr, 2025 at 06:00 pm
Eaglewood Resort & Spa
USD 749
Home
Events in Itasca
Relaxation Events in Itasca